The Blooming Begins: Spotting the Signs

🌸 Pre-Flower Excitement

Anticipation mounts as the Carolina Elephantsfoot prepares to bloom. Subtle changes in the plant's appearance are your first clue. You might notice a slight bulge in the foliage, a prelude to the floral spectacle that awaits. This is the plant's way of whispering, "Get ready."

🌼 The Grand Reveal

When the Carolina Elephantsfoot finally unfurls its flowers, it's a sight to behold. The blossoms, ranging from white to pale violet, emerge between July and October. They stand tall, reaching heights of 12 to 40 inches, and command attention with their rapid growth and unique beauty.

Encouraging More Flowers

🌸 Fine-Tuning for More Blooms

To encourage more frequent and vibrant blooms in Carolina Elephantsfoot, a few adjustments are necessary. Light is a crucial ally; ensure your plant receives bright, indirect sunlight. This is the equivalent of a plant's personal trainer, urging it towards its blooming potential.

Watering should be preciseβ€”too much, and you risk a wilted mess; too little, and you're in drought territory. Aim for that Goldilocks zone: just right.

When it comes to fertilization, timing is everything. Start in late winter and continue until late summer, then taper off. Over-fertilization can be a blooming blockade, so keep it balanced.
